Compare Coppell to Duncanville

This post compares Coppell, Texas to Duncanville, Texas across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Coppell (city) Duncanville (city)
Population 41,138 39,636
Income (median) $81,054 $38,839
Home Value (median) $344,300 $128,100
White 69% 57%
Black 4% 35%
Asian 22% 0%
With Kids 45% 37%
Age (median) 40 36
Rentals 28% 35%

Questions and Answers:

Q: Which is more populated, Coppell or Duncanville?
A: Coppell has a similar population count than Duncanville: 41138 compared with 39636 total people.

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in Coppell or in Duncanville?
A: Incomes are on average much higher in Coppell.

Q: Are homes more expensive in Coppell or Duncanville?
A: Homes tend to be much more expensive in Coppell.

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: Duncanville does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 28% for Coppell versus 35% for Duncanville.
